I do all new codes, and 2-4 pages (100per page) each day on icm. I've done a handful of temp codes, but mainly regular. Should regular or temp be the priority?
-
If I only have 5 mins to punch I always go for a few temps.
Some people don't like the temp codes because when they then punch the regular codes they get a lot of duplicates. Personally I think the temp codes are the most valuable as you know these are players that have been active in the last 7 days max so most likely to accept your invite. If you do the regular codes added to ICM each day and stay up to date on the temps you will be punching 150-200 codes a day typically and get around 80-120 mob per day. So even setting a small amount of time each day you can keep growing at a good pace.
